| 5 weeks 6 days ago | A somewhat different experience. |
I actually don't remember my undergrad acceptance, probably because I wasn't that set on one school or another. But Law School acceptance was interesting. I was a senior at UM, and had the LSAT score and GPA to be pretty selective myself. I wanted to stay in Ann Arbor, because obviously.And I had a grlfriend (now my wife of 32 years) here. In the fall of 1977 I paid my money, wroe my essys, and applied to UM, Northwestern, and U of C. Winter of 78 rolled around, and I was accepted first at U of C and then at Northwestern. Classmates of mine had heard from UM and had gotten in, but I still had heard nothing.Then it was March, and it was time to make some plans, but I still hadn't heard. So, I stopped into the Law School admissions office in office in Hutchins Hall. There was a counter and a nice lady at the counter. Behind the counter were several long tables with boxes and boxes of applications. Everything was, of course, on paper, and the boxes were alphabetized. I approached the counter and explained to the lady that I had applied months ago and was still waiting, and that I had to make a decision soon. She said to hang on, and she would check my application (apparently, the applications were considered, marked accepted, waitlist, or declined, and returned to the boxes). She checked the box where my application should have been and it was not there. She checked another box that could have made sense given my last name, and it was not there. I was not too happy, because I knew it had gotten there because I had dropped it off. Finally, she actually got down on the floor and looked under and behind the tables. She then crawled under the table and got back up holding my application, which apparently had slid behind and fallen to the floor. We were both relieved, but I wondered how long I would have to wait to hear. She told me to hang on for a minute, and walked across the hall to ask the Director of Admissions how long it would be. When she came back after just a minute or 2, she said "You're in.". So, keep your email recepits. |
